Built motion from commit f3ee9a8.|1.0.18
[motion.git] / server / config / smtp / index.js
1 var _0xdbab=["\x75\x73\x65\x20\x73\x74\x72\x69\x63\x74","\x75\x74\x69\x6C","\x6C\x6F\x64\x61\x73\x68","\x63\x68\x69\x6C\x64\x5F\x70\x72\x6F\x63\x65\x73\x73","\x4D\x61\x69\x6C\x53\x65\x72\x76\x65\x72\x4F\x75\x74","\x2E\x2E\x2F\x2E\x2E\x2F\x6D\x6F\x64\x65\x6C\x73","\x4D\x61\x69\x6C\x4D\x65\x73\x73\x61\x67\x65","\x4D\x61\x69\x6C\x52\x6F\x6F\x6D","\x4D\x61\x69\x6C\x41\x63\x63\x6F\x75\x6E\x74","\x6D\x61\x69\x6C","\x2E\x2E\x2F\x6C\x6F\x67\x67\x65\x72\x2E\x6A\x73","\x65\x72\x72\x6F\x72","\x53\x4D\x54\x50\x20\x53\x45\x52\x56\x45\x52\x20\x25\x73\x20\x28\x25\x73\x20\x2D\x20\x25\x73\x29\x20\x45\x52\x52\x4F\x52","\x66\x6F\x72\x6D\x61\x74","\x6F\x6E","\x63\x6C\x6F\x73\x65","\x53\x4D\x54\x50\x20\x53\x45\x52\x56\x45\x52\x20\x25\x73\x20\x28\x25\x73\x20\x2D\x20\x25\x73\x29\x20\x45\x58\x49\x54\x45\x44\x20\x57\x49\x54\x48\x20\x43\x4F\x44\x45\x20\x25\x73","\x69\x6E\x66\x6F","\x6D\x65\x73\x73\x61\x67\x65","\x74\x79\x70\x65","\x75\x70\x64\x61\x74\x65","\x73\x74\x61\x74\x75\x73","\x74\x68\x65\x6E","\x72\x6F\x6F\x6D\x49\x64","\x66\x69\x6E\x64\x42\x79\x49\x64","\x6D\x73\x67\x49\x64","\x73\x74\x61\x74\x65","\x73\x74\x61\x63\x6B","\x63\x61\x74\x63\x68","\x73\x6F\x75\x72\x63\x65","\x2F\x73\x6D\x74\x70","\x66\x6F\x72\x6B","\x65\x78\x70\x6F\x72\x74\x73","\x65\x78\x69\x74","\x73\x6D\x74\x70","\x6B\x69\x6C\x6C","\x73\x6D\x70\x74","\x66\x72\x6F\x6D","\x64\x61\x74\x61\x56\x61\x6C\x75\x65\x73","\x72\x65\x74\x72\x79\x53\x65\x6E\x64","\x73\x65\x6E\x64","\x61\x66\x74\x65\x72\x43\x72\x65\x61\x74\x65","\x63\x68\x61\x6E\x67\x65\x64","\x53\x45\x4E\x44\x49\x4E\x47","\x72\x65\x74\x72\x79","\x68\x74\x6D\x6C","\x75\x74\x66\x38","\x74\x65\x78\x74","\x61\x66\x74\x65\x72\x55\x70\x64\x61\x74\x65","\x69\x64","\x75\x73\x65\x72\x6E\x61\x6D\x65","\x4D\x61\x69\x6C\x41\x63\x63\x6F\x75\x6E\x74\x49\x64","\x66\x69\x6E\x64","\x6D\x61\x69\x6C\x53\x65\x72\x76\x65\x72\x4F\x75\x74\x49\x64","\x61\x64\x64\x72\x65\x73\x73","\x53\x4D\x54\x50\x20\x53\x45\x52\x56\x45\x52\x20\x25\x73\x20\x28\x25\x73\x20\x2D\x20\x25\x73\x29\x20\x55\x50\x44\x41\x54\x45\x44\x2C\x20\x50\x52\x4F\x43\x45\x53\x53\x20\x49\x44\x3A\x20\x25\x73\x20","\x70\x69\x64","\x68\x6F\x73\x74","\x70\x61\x73\x73\x77\x6F\x72\x64","\x70\x6F\x72\x74","\x73\x73\x6C","\x53\x4D\x54\x50\x20\x53\x45\x52\x56\x45\x52\x20\x25\x73\x20\x28\x25\x73\x20\x2D\x20\x25\x73\x29\x20\x44\x45\x53\x54\x52\x4F\x59\x45\x44\x2C\x20\x50\x52\x4F\x43\x45\x53\x53\x20\x49\x44\x3A\x20\x25\x73\x20","\x61\x66\x74\x65\x72\x44\x65\x73\x74\x72\x6F\x79","\x66\x6F\x72\x45\x61\x63\x68","\x66\x69\x6E\x64\x41\x6C\x6C"];_0xdbab[0];var util=require(_0xdbab[1]);var _=require(_0xdbab[2]);var cp=require(_0xdbab[3]);var ms=require(_0xdbab[5])[_0xdbab[4]];var msg=require(_0xdbab[5])[_0xdbab[6]];var rm=require(_0xdbab[5])[_0xdbab[7]];var ma=require(_0xdbab[5])[_0xdbab[8]];var logger=require(_0xdbab[10])(_0xdbab[9]);function fork(_0xdb3fxa,_0xdb3fxb,_0xdb3fxc){return cp[_0xdbab[31]](__dirname+ _0xdbab[30],[_0xdb3fxa,_0xdb3fxb])[_0xdbab[14]](_0xdbab[18],function(_0xdb3fxf){if(_0xdb3fxf[_0xdbab[19]]=== _0xdbab[20]){return msg[_0xdbab[24]](_0xdb3fxf[_0xdbab[25]])[_0xdbab[22]](function(_0xdb3fx11){return _0xdb3fx11[_0xdbab[20]](_0xdb3fxf)})[_0xdbab[22]](function(){return rm[_0xdbab[24]](_0xdb3fxf[_0xdbab[23]])})[_0xdbab[22]](function(_0xdb3fx10){return _0xdb3fx10[_0xdbab[20]]({lastEvent:_0xdb3fxf[_0xdbab[21]]})})};if(_0xdb3fxf[_0xdbab[19]]=== _0xdbab[26]){return ms[_0xdbab[24]](_0xdb3fxa)[_0xdbab[22]](function(_0xdb3fx12){return _0xdb3fx12[_0xdbab[20]]({state:_0xdb3fxf[_0xdbab[26]],source:_0xdb3fxf[_0xdbab[29]]|| null})})[_0xdbab[28]](function(_0xdb3fxd){logger[_0xdbab[11]](_0xdb3fxd[_0xdbab[27]])})}})[_0xdbab[14]](_0xdbab[15],function(_0xdb3fxe){logger[_0xdbab[17]](util[_0xdbab[13]](_0xdbab[16],_0xdb3fxa,_0xdb3fxc,_0xdb3fxb,_0xdb3fxe))})[_0xdbab[14]](_0xdbab[11],function(_0xdb3fxd){logger[_0xdbab[11]](util[_0xdbab[13]](_0xdbab[12],_0xdb3fxa,_0xdb3fxc,_0xdb3fxb),_0xdb3fxd)})}module[_0xdbab[32]]= function(){var _0xdb3fx13={};process[_0xdbab[14]](_0xdbab[33],function(_0xdb3fxe){for(var _0xdb3fx14 in _0xdb3fx13){if(_0xdb3fx13[_0xdb3fx14][_0xdbab[34]]){_0xdb3fx13[_0xdb3fx14][_0xdbab[36]][_0xdbab[35]]()}}});msg[_0xdbab[41]](function(_0xdb3fx11){if(_0xdb3fx13[_0xdb3fx11[_0xdbab[37]]]){_0xdb3fx11[_0xdbab[38]][_0xdbab[19]]= _0xdbab[18];_0xdb3fx11[_0xdbab[38]][_0xdbab[39]]= 0;_0xdb3fx13[_0xdb3fx11[_0xdbab[37]]][_0xdbab[34]][_0xdbab[40]](_0xdb3fx11[_0xdbab[38]])}});msg[_0xdbab[48]](function(_0xdb3fx11){if(_0xdb3fx11[_0xdbab[42]](_0xdbab[21])&& _0xdb3fx11[_0xdbab[21]]=== _0xdbab[43]){if(_0xdb3fx13[_0xdb3fx11[_0xdbab[37]]]){_0xdb3fx11[_0xdbab[38]][_0xdbab[19]]= _0xdbab[18];_0xdb3fx11[_0xdbab[38]][_0xdbab[39]]= _0xdb3fx11[_0xdbab[38]][_0xdbab[44]]+ 1;_0xdb3fx11[_0xdbab[38]][_0xdbab[45]]= _0xdb3fx11[_0xdbab[38]][_0xdbab[45]]?_0xdb3fx11[_0xdbab[38]][_0xdbab[45]].toString(_0xdbab[46]):null;_0xdb3fx11[_0xdbab[38]][_0xdbab[47]]= _0xdb3fx11[_0xdbab[38]][_0xdbab[47]]?_0xdb3fx11[_0xdbab[38]][_0xdbab[47]].toString(_0xdbab[46]):null;_0xdb3fx13[_0xdb3fx11[_0xdbab[37]]][_0xdbab[34]][_0xdbab[40]](_0xdb3fx11[_0xdbab[38]])}}});ms[_0xdbab[41]](function(_0xdb3fx12){if(_0xdb3fx12[_0xdbab[49]]&& _0xdb3fx12[_0xdbab[50]]){var _0xdb3fx15=_[_0xdbab[52]](_0xdb3fx13,{mailAccountId:_0xdb3fx12[_0xdbab[51]]});if(_0xdb3fx15){_0xdb3fx15[_0xdbab[53]]= _0xdb3fx12[_0xdbab[49]];_0xdb3fx15[_0xdbab[50]]= _0xdb3fx12[_0xdbab[50]];_0xdb3fx15[_0xdbab[34]]= fork(_0xdb3fx12[_0xdbab[49]],_0xdb3fx12[_0xdbab[50]],_0xdb3fx15[_0xdbab[54]])}}});ma[_0xdbab[41]](function(_0xdb3fx16){if(_0xdb3fx16[_0xdbab[49]]&& _0xdb3fx16[_0xdbab[54]]){_0xdb3fx13[_0xdb3fx16[_0xdbab[54]]]= {mailAccountId:_0xdb3fx16[_0xdbab[49]],address:_0xdb3fx16[_0xdbab[54]]}}});ma[_0xdbab[48]](function(_0xdb3fx16){if(_0xdb3fx16[_0xdbab[42]](_0xdbab[54])){var _0xdb3fx15=_[_0xdbab[52]](_0xdb3fx13,{mailAccountId:_0xdb3fx16[_0xdbab[49]]});if(_0xdb3fx15){var _0xdb3fx17=_0xdb3fx15[_0xdbab[53]];var _0xdb3fxb=_0xdb3fx15[_0xdbab[50]];var _0xdb3fxc=_0xdb3fx15[_0xdbab[54]];_0xdb3fx15[_0xdbab[34]][_0xdbab[35]]();_0xdb3fx15= null;delete _0xdb3fx13[_0xdb3fxc];_0xdb3fx13[_0xdb3fx16[_0xdbab[54]]]= {mailAccountId:_0xdb3fx16[_0xdbab[49]],mailServerOutId:_0xdb3fx17,address:_0xdb3fx16[_0xdbab[54]],username:_0xdb3fxb,smtp:fork(_0xdb3fx17,_0xdb3fxb,_0xdb3fx16[_0xdbab[54]])};logger[_0xdbab[17]](util[_0xdbab[13]](_0xdbab[55],_0xdb3fx17,_0xdb3fx16[_0xdbab[54]],_0xdb3fxb,_0xdb3fx13[_0xdb3fx16[_0xdbab[54]]][_0xdbab[34]][_0xdbab[56]]))}}});ms[_0xdbab[48]](function(_0xdb3fx12){var _0xdb3fx15=_[_0xdbab[52]](_0xdb3fx13,{mailAccountId:_0xdb3fx12[_0xdbab[51]]});if(_0xdb3fx15){if((!_0xdb3fx12[_0xdbab[42]](_0xdbab[26])&&  !_0xdb3fx12[_0xdbab[42]](_0xdbab[29])) || _0xdb3fx12[_0xdbab[42]](_0xdbab[57]) || _0xdb3fx12[_0xdbab[42]](_0xdbab[50]) || _0xdb3fx12[_0xdbab[42]](_0xdbab[58]) || _0xdb3fx12[_0xdbab[42]](_0xdbab[59]) || _0xdb3fx12[_0xdbab[42]](_0xdbab[60])){_0xdb3fx15[_0xdbab[34]][_0xdbab[35]]();_0xdb3fx15[_0xdbab[34]]= null;_0xdb3fx15[_0xdbab[50]]= _0xdb3fx12[_0xdbab[50]];_0xdb3fx15[_0xdbab[34]]= fork(_0xdb3fx15[_0xdbab[53]],_0xdb3fx12[_0xdbab[50]],_0xdb3fx15[_0xdbab[54]]);logger[_0xdbab[17]](util[_0xdbab[13]](_0xdbab[55],_0xdb3fx12[_0xdbab[49]],_0xdb3fx15[_0xdbab[54]],_0xdb3fx15[_0xdbab[50]],_0xdb3fx15[_0xdbab[34]][_0xdbab[56]]))}else {_0xdb3fx15[_0xdbab[34]][_0xdbab[40]]({type:_0xdbab[26],state:_0xdb3fx12[_0xdbab[26]],source:_0xdb3fx12[_0xdbab[29]],username:_0xdb3fx12[_0xdbab[50]]})}}});ms[_0xdbab[62]](function(_0xdb3fx12){var _0xdb3fx15=_[_0xdbab[52]](_0xdb3fx13,{mailAccountId:_0xdb3fx12[_0xdbab[51]]});if(_0xdb3fx15){logger[_0xdbab[17]](util[_0xdbab[13]](_0xdbab[61],_0xdb3fx12[_0xdbab[49]],_0xdb3fx15[_0xdbab[54]],_0xdb3fx15[_0xdbab[50]],_0xdb3fx15[_0xdbab[34]][_0xdbab[56]]));var _0xdb3fxc=_0xdb3fx15[_0xdbab[54]];_0xdb3fx15[_0xdbab[34]][_0xdbab[35]]();_0xdb3fx15= null;delete _0xdb3fx13[_0xdb3fxc]}});ma[_0xdbab[62]](function(_0xdb3fx16){var _0xdb3fx15=_[_0xdbab[52]](_0xdb3fx13,{mailAccountId:_0xdb3fx16[_0xdbab[49]]});if(_0xdb3fx15){logger[_0xdbab[17]](util[_0xdbab[13]](_0xdbab[61],_0xdb3fx15[_0xdbab[53]],_0xdb3fx15[_0xdbab[54]],_0xdb3fx15[_0xdbab[50]],_0xdb3fx15[_0xdbab[34]][_0xdbab[56]]));var _0xdb3fxc=_0xdb3fx15[_0xdbab[54]];_0xdb3fx15[_0xdbab[34]][_0xdbab[35]]();_0xdb3fx15= null;delete _0xdb3fx13[_0xdb3fxc]}});ma[_0xdbab[64]]({include:[ms]})[_0xdbab[22]](function(_0xdb3fx18){_0xdb3fx18[_0xdbab[63]](function(_0xdb3fx16){if(_0xdb3fx16[_0xdbab[4]]){_0xdb3fx13[_0xdb3fx16[_0xdbab[54]]]= {mailAccountId:_0xdb3fx16[_0xdbab[49]],mailServerOutId:_0xdb3fx16[_0xdbab[4]][_0xdbab[49]],address:_0xdb3fx16[_0xdbab[54]],username:_0xdb3fx16[_0xdbab[4]][_0xdbab[50]],smtp:fork(_0xdb3fx16[_0xdbab[4]][_0xdbab[49]],_0xdb3fx16[_0xdbab[4]][_0xdbab[50]],_0xdb3fx16[_0xdbab[54]])}}})})[_0xdbab[28]](function(_0xdb3fxd){logger[_0xdbab[11]](_0xdb3fxd)})}